Head of ICT and Computer Science job summary

Head of ICT and Computer Science

We are looking for an inspirational and forward-thinking existing Head of subject or an ambitious teacher to lead the evolution of the curriculum. This is an exciting time to be leading a subject that plays such a crucial role of informing and daily life and is only likely to increase its importance in the future.

ICT is currently delivered to KS3 and covers a range of topics. Computer science is a new course we are introducing from September 2024 at GCSE but we are keen to make this a key part of our curriculum offer at KS4 and KS5.

The school was accredited as World Class in July 2021 and as such, we are committed to providing a world-class education for every student through a well-designed and balanced curriculum. Our established culture provides a calm, safe and stimulating learning environment.

Ethical leadership is at the core of all decision making at Southfield. As such, staff are valued, treated with respect and afforded a diverse range of opportunities that come with professional trust. We place significant emphasis on working collegiately as a staff to share our expertise and subsequently enhance the learning experience with our students. Every member of the staff is involved in a variety of professional learning programmes that take place every Wednesday across the academic year. All teachers are members of the Chartered College of Teaching providing access to the latest evidence and research.

You would be joining a friendly, hard-working team, with an ethos of collaborative planning and shared resources.

The post will commence in September 2024 but we would consider an earlier start date if the candidate was available.

Southfield School for Girls is a high performing girls school that admits boys to the sixth form.

Consistently in the top 5% in the country for Progress 8 scores we offer a rounded education where the 'whole' student is a top priority and academic excellence is matched by high quality pastoral care and excellent opportunities for every student to be outstanding both in and out of school.

A licensed DofE provider - we live what we teach.
